Transaction 58fa4536db3785bdb614b239b12ae4837e03631f7f557a935e74cfb0b052bc31
1 Input
1 Output
-
58fa4536db3785bdb614b239b12ae4837e03631f7f557a935e74cfb0b052bc31:0
- value
- 2032056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ba43153a8334f479535465f0679d20ae12f30713 OP_EQUAL
- address
- 3JfsyE9Xevw6MoZGLMSS2cjqRDDdgjZGZN